Section 1: Emerging Trends in Geometric Coding

One of the most significant trends in geometric coding is the increasing use of machine learning and artificial intelligence (AI) techniques to generate and optimize geometric models. This approach enables developers to create more complex and realistic environments, characters, and objects, while also reducing the time and effort required for manual modeling. Another trend is the growing importance of physics-based rendering, which allows for more accurate and realistic simulations of real-world phenomena, such as lighting, water, and destruction. By mastering geometric coding, developers can unlock new levels of visual fidelity and immersion in their games.

Section 2: Innovations in Geometric Coding Tools and Software

The geometric coding landscape is constantly evolving, with new tools and software emerging to support the development of more sophisticated and efficient geometric models. One notable innovation is the rise of open-source geometric coding libraries, such as Open3D and PCL, which provide developers with a flexible and customizable framework for building and manipulating geometric models. Another significant development is the integration of geometric coding with popular game engines, such as Unity and Unreal Engine, which enables developers to leverage the power of geometric coding in their game development workflows. By staying up-to-date with the latest tools and software, developers can streamline their workflows and focus on creating innovative and engaging gaming experiences.

Section 3: Applications of Geometric Coding in Game Development

Geometric coding has a wide range of applications in game development, from creating realistic environments and characters to simulating complex physical phenomena. One exciting area of application is the development of virtual reality (VR) and augmented reality (AR) experiences, which rely heavily on geometric coding to create immersive and interactive environments. Another area of application is the creation of procedural content, such as terrain, cities, and buildings, which can be generated using geometric coding techniques. By leveraging geometric coding, developers can create more realistic, engaging, and dynamic gaming experiences that captivate and inspire players.
